The Vehicle of Life is Driven by God!

HE has the ultimate GPS—God’s Purposed System. When you sit as a passenger in a car with someone that is known for perfect driving skills, you know that you are in safe hands.  You can truly rest and trust in the decisions of the driver and know that you will arrive safely to your destination.  This is true when considering God is the expert driver and we are the anxious passenger.

We make the choice to jump out of the vehicle at every speed bump—falling to the ground, crying, worrying, and seeking comfort in the arms of anyone nearby. Of course, there will be moments when God allows us to get out, take a breath, and process our emotions. Hopefully, those around us will offer Godly counsel, gently guiding us back to the vehicle where God has been patiently waiting with His foot on the brake.

Inevitably, we get back in—not because we have all the answers, but because we trust that God is able. He’s done it before, and He will do it again. The brake is there so we can take a moment to feel and be human, but it was never meant to be a permanent stop. We are not called to park—we are called to move forward, gradually and purposefully.

Now, be mindful: who is driving your vehicle?

If you’re riding with the enemy, you’ll know it. The journey will be chaotic—hitting every pothole, every speed bump, making reckless turns, ignoring Godly counsel. You will never rest. You can’t. You're being jolted around, your nerves are constantly on edge, and fear takes the place of peace. How can you think positively? How can you believe you will survive and thrive when not even the seatbelt can hold you securely.  Your face print is left on the window. The enemy wants you to get banged up or leap out the vehicle because that is when he hopes we will be too hurt to pray or have faith.

Get in the vehicle with God!

Put on your seatbelt and arrive safely at your destination.

And when you do, don’t forget to say thank you—and give God a 5-star rating!

Because the true win is helping someone else get there too!
